From the archive: "angry" atheists — Russell Glasser and Matt Dillahunty talk about why atheists (in particular Richard Dawkins) are often falsely perceived as being angry. Russel does a dramatic reading of an artcle by rabbi Marc Gellman, and Matt swiftly ends one of the shortest prank calls in the show's history.

This is a long excerpt from The Atheist Experience #506 of June 24, 2007 (topic: "angry" atheists) with a slightly improved audio track. The very noisy and small (320 x 240 pixels) video of the complete episode is archived on Google Video:

WHAT IS THE ATHEIST EXPERIENCE?

The Atheist Experience is a weekly cable access television show in Austin, Texas geared at a non-atheist audience. The Atheist Experience is produced by the Atheist Community of Austin. The Atheist Community of Austin is organized as a nonprofit educational corporation to develop and support the atheist community, to provide opportunities for socializing and friendship, to promote secular viewpoints, to encourage positive atheist culture, to defend the first amendment principle of state-church separation, to oppose discrimination against atheists and to work with other organizations in pursuit of common goals.
